Popular places to visit
Warner Bros. Movie World
Watch stunt shows, get on superhero rides, enter the Ice Age 4D Experience and take a splash in the Wild West at Australia’s theme park version of Hollywood.
Cairns Esplanade
Stroll along the boardwalk surrounded by palms tree and landscaped gardens and watch the sun set over the Coral Sea.
Australia Zoo
Cuddle a koala, feed kangaroos or watch a crocodile show at this famous wildlife park, the former playground of the late crocodile hunter Steve Irwin.
Cavill Avenue
Bustling nightlife, great shopping and a legendary surfing beach make this avenue the exciting centre of Surfer’s Paradise on the Gold Coast.
Hastings Street
Located in the heart of Noosa Heads, this beachside street is a chic enclave of cosmopolitan cafés, resort-style accommodation and designer shopping.
Roma Street Parkland
Stroll through this inner-city oasis with lake, subtropical flowers, native plants, public art and water features.
Sea World
Who doesn’t dream of staying overnight in a water park where you can see Jet Ski stunts, life-sized Nickelodeon stars, plus dolphins, sea lions and polar bears?
South Bank Parklands
Explore the great outdoors at South Bank Parklands, a lovely green space in Brisbane. Stroll along the riverfront in this family-friendly area or visit its top-notch restaurants.
